my bike was doing something similar. i had a VERY weak spark the only time i could see it was in a dark garage. I took the wiring harness off, shortened it, pulled off all the butt connectors that the yahoo before me had on there, made sure all the connections were soldered good, and taped it up. BEAUTIFUL spark now. from expierence, will knock the s#$t out of ya. IMO its in the wiring like the above posts said